Who we are ?

Pierre Fabre is the 2nd largest dermo-cosmetics laboratory in the world, the 2nd largest private French pharmaceutical group and the market leader in France for products sold over the counter in pharmacies. Its portfolio includes several medical franchises and international brands including Pierre Fabre Oncologie, Pierre Fabre Dermatologie, Eau Thermale Avène, Klorane, Ducray, René Furterer, A-Derma, Naturactive, Pierre Fabre Oral Care.

Your mission

Under the responsibility of the CFO, and in coordination with Finance HQ teams, as well as our distributors, the Finance Controller’s responsibilities are to support day to day operations and assist top management with decision making. As a Business Partner, take responsibility at an operational level and participate in steering activity performance.

 

Main responsibilities / job expectations:

  • Work closely with external accountant for daily activity and month end closing.
  • Manage the end-to-end expense control process, including the collection, verification, and validation of supplier invoices and employee expense claims, and coordinate with the external accounting firm to ensure accurate booking in the ERP system.
  • Elaborate rolling forecasts, budget, estimates and long-term plan for the entrusted scope of activities and in accordance with the company’s standards & procedures.
  • Provide management with timely and insightful financial and business analysis, monitor KPIs and performance versus budget and forecast, and proactively identify risks, opportunities, and action plans to achieve targets.
  • Monitor sales (Sell in /Sell out/inventory), prices and commercial policy application.
  • Contribute on improving processes, tools, automation (including but not limited to forecasting/budgeting process, management reporting process and any other business needs).
  • Develop financial models and build business cases to evaluate new business opportunities / Support mid-term and long-term strategic topics.
  • Prepare and assist with required information for internal and external audits.
  • Credit Management for all Export area and assist on cash collection.
  • Ensure compliance with management rules and ensure the proper functioning of the financial processes in force within the company.

About Pierre Fabre Laboratories

Laboratoires Pierre Fabre held by the Pierre Fabre Foundation, is a worldwide company with a unique positioning : the alliance of pharmaceutical and dermocosmetics expertise.

This makes Pierre Fabre Group :
💊 A pharmaceutical group with a strong positioning : medical and natural
🥈 The second largest dermo-cosmetics laboratory in the world
🥈 The second largest private French pharmaceutical group
🥇 The market leader in France for products sold over the counter in pharmacies.

Established in the Occitanie region since its creation, we manufacture over 95% of our products in France. We keep innovating passionately with our teams in 2 innovation centers in Brasil and Japan as well as in 6 R&D centers in France.

Thanks to our 9,600 employees in 44 subsidiaries and our distribution activities in 120 countries, our group generated €2.7 billion in revenues in 2022, 69% of which is from international business.

Pierre Fabre Group has a unique company structure.
86% of the Pierre Fabre Group is held by the Pierre Fabre Foundation, a government-recognized public-interest foundation, while a smaller share is owned by its employees via an employee stock ownership plan.

In 2020, the independent organization ECOCERT Environment awarded Pierre Fabre's CSR policy at "excellence" level : - Excellence being the highest maturity level of the ECOCERT 26000 standard.
